Abstract
Mobile cloud computing (MCC) has become increasingly popular due to its ability to provide access to cloud services through mobile devices. However, data sharing between mobile devices and cloud servers in MCC raises several security and efficiency challenges. In this paper, we propose a modeling and simulation framework using MATLAB to evaluate and optimize data sharing mechanisms in MCC. We consider different approaches such as encryption, access control, and data compression, and evaluate their performance under different scenarios and parameters. Our simulation results provide insights into the strengths and weaknesses of different data sharing mechanisms and offer guidelines on how to optimize data sharing in MCC. Our framework can serve as a valuable tool for researchers and practitioners to design, implement and evaluate efficient and secure data sharing mechanisms in MCC.
